We live in a culture that often views aging as a problem to be solved and brain changes as a purely medical crisis. Yet, for followers of Jesus Christ, the journey of growing older is a profound and sacred part of discipleship, a season that challenges, refines, and deepens our faith: we are called to embody God’s love in every stage of life. Whether you identify as one who is experiencing brain changes, or as one caring for and loving someone who is, this four-part series is an invitation to move beyond cultural anxieties and instead explore aging and brain change through the hopeful, compassionate lens of our Christian faith.
This session is titled Brain Changes with Teepa Snow (The Snow Approach™) – Come learn ways to improve the quality of life for those living with brain changes caused by dementia or other conditions.
